## Authentication

The Fernwell partner SFTP drop at the Calderbrook site is polled every fifteen minutes by the ingest worker. SSH credentials for the drop itself live in the Vaultlet store under the `fernwell-sftp` path; on-call does not need to touch those directly. What you will need is the key for the internal Relay-Courier API, which the worker uses to register each pulled file. It rotates quarterly. The current key is below.

app token of tagef-tafog = qvz3-7n0

### Step 7: Enable offline mode

Switch Fernpath survey clients to offline-first sync before decommissioning the old relay. Verify that queued observations replay in order and that conflict resolution favours the field copy. Once the relay is drained, update each gateway with the offline configuration values below.

settings of tagef-bawif:
DRUIX_HOST=druix.zemvarlabs.internal
DRUIX_PORT=8000

# Env file for the Bellwick alert deduplicator (prod).
# Release manager notes: rotate values here during the release window only,
# since the dedup workers cache config at boot. DEDUP_WINDOW_SECONDS and
# DEDUP_FANOUT_LIMIT are safe to tune live; everything else needs a restart.
# The broker auth secret the workers require goes on the next line.

sealed setting: VAULT_KEY20=39d48de497b3678643bc

## Signing artifacts for the Quillmark pipeline

Every build of the Quillmark markdown renderer produces a tarball containing the parser, sanitizer, and theme assets. Before any artifact is published to the Inkfold registry, it must be signed so downstream consumers at Verrowtech can verify integrity. The signing step runs automatically in CI, but new team members should also know how to sign locally when testing release candidates. Local signing uses the team's shared release key, reproduced below for convenience.

rollout seal: bky4_DFM9